The gray wolf is not a lonely animal and it must live in packs so that it can fully flourish. Indeed, the perfect social cohesion that reigns within wolf packs allows them to hunt, occupy a territory and communicate without any difficulty. The pack is therefore a family group, generally composed of a dozen individuals. The scheme of a pack is normally made up of a dominant couple, and wolves that this couple gave birth to years ago. Each pack has its own territory that it is responsible for defending against any intruder. The dimensions of the territory of a gray wolf pack vary according to food resources in the environment, but in principle it covers no less than several hundred square kilometers. The limits of this territory are marked by odoriferous deposits in order to notify the rival packs.
